Biography

High School: Three-time men's basketball high school champion in Stockholm...won the national title with the Solna Vikings U20 team.

National Experience: Played over 30 games for the Swedish youth national team.

Varsity:

2018-19:
Dressed for 23 regular season games...averaged 10.6 points per game...ranked second on the team with 5.3 rebounds per game and third with 34 assists...notched a career-high 25 points vs York on Feb. 16...recorded a career-high 13 rebounds vs Western on Nov. 23. 

2017-18: Dressed for 23 regular season games and one playoff game...during the regular season, averaged 9.5 points and ranked second on the team with 5.0 rebounds per game and seven blocks...notched a season-high 23 points vs Ryerson on Nov. 29...recorded a season-high 11 rebounds twice this season.

2016-17: Dressed for 19 regular season and two playoff games...during the regular season, ranked fourth on the team with 9.5 points and 4.1 rebounds per game...led the team with five blocks...recorded a season-high 18 points vs Laurentian on Nov. 18...recorded a season-high nine rebounds twice this season.

2015-16: Dressed for 19 games, averaging 21.6 minutes per game...averaged 7.1 points and ranked third on the team with 4.3 boards per game...notched a season-high 18 points vs Brock on Feb. 5...recorded a season-high seven rebounds twice this season...named a member of the OUA all-rookie team. 

Personal: Father won the national soccer championship in high school...Brother is a goalkeeper for the AIK academy in Stockholm.
